O.C.G.A. 46-11-2 (2010)
46-11-2. Purpose of chapter


The General Assembly finds that the transportation of hazardous materials on the public roads of this state presents a unique and potentially catastrophic hazard to the public health, safety, and welfare of the people of Georgia and that the protection of the public health, safety, and welfare requires control and regulation of such transportation to minimize that hazard; to that end this chapter is enacted. The Department of Public Safety is designated as the agency to implement this chapter.
